Funny thing is the KV-27FS12 has no control for digital convergence and no controls inside and looks miserable.
On non delta-gun CRT sets that are too old to have menu based convergence correction the convergence adjustments are a set of rings on the neck of the CRT that resemble the purity rings(the purity rings are usually in the same cluster and are hard to tell apart). There are good instructions on the net for preforming purity and convergence adjustments on sets like yours.
